Monté de Watterdal is a climb in the region Caps et Marais d'Opale. It is 3.3 km long and bridges 94 m of vertical ascent with an average gradient of 2.9%, resulting in a difficulty score of 40. The top of the ascent is located at 203 m above sea level. Climbfinder users shared 1 review/story of this climb and uploaded 0 photos.

Long climb in the area, no high percentages. Prepare for a winding road between trees and fields, no houses or traffic to be found. Blessed for those who want to test the legs on a longer incline.
